Abstract | An auditory rhyme detection task was employed to examine orthographic code development in 27 reading-disabled and 27 normally achieving children (ages 7-11 years). It was concluded that children with a reading disability have a lessened ability to automatically access and make available stored lexical information relating to orthography. (Author/DB) |
